The Rise Recalibration

The fit evolution most bodies request: mid-to-high rises (the waist-defined comfort that low rises never offered anyone), the curve-cut expansions (the waist-gap problem finally engineered), and the stretch-with-structure fabrics (the rigid romance versus the all-day reality — the premium blends split it). The fit upgrade IS the after-forty denim story; the age was incidental.

The Wash Sophistication

The polish variable: darker washes and clean finishes carry the elevated register (the blazer-and-dark-denim formula is the decade’s uniform for a reason), mid-washes hold the weekend lane, and the distressing dial turns by taste, not birthday (the whiskered wash reads relaxed; the shredded knee just reads shredded — at every age).

The Skinny Armistice

The cut discourse, settled: the skinny survives (with boots, under tunics — its jobs remain), the straight and wide legs lead the era, the flare serves the heel days, and the barrel and horseshoe cuts audition for the adventurous. The ‘too old for skinny jeans’ take was never fashion — it was the age-rule mythology in denim’s clothing. Wear the cuts; rotate the eras.

The Styling Maturity

The decade’s denim formulas: dark straight + blazer + loafer (the meeting-proof), wide leg + fine knit + sneaker (the modern casual), the Canadian-tuxedo-done-right (tonal washes, one structured piece), and the fit-over-trend rule governing all: the tailored hem, the honest size, the cut that serves YOUR proportions. Denim after forty was always just denim — with better fit data and a firmer signature.

Rises up, washes darker, every cut licensed, tailor on retainer. The denim question was never ‘still allowed?’ — it was ‘which fits serve the life?’, and the decade answers with better jeans than the twenties ever owned.
